			<content:encoded><![CDATA[<p>Before 2001, few knew in the crowd the name &#8220;Tolkien&#8221; or the designation &#8220;Lord of the Rings.&#8221; Most associates rightly so books, but read it, they had only a handful. In 1999, Peter Jackson did it, these novels to adapt in all its complexity on the screen and get closer to the mainstream without forgetting its many facets and levels of activity. And he stuck to his ideas and specifications: He underlined passages from the novels or offset them in the timeline, and yet he remained true to the universe, making it suitable for mass production. But the long-established Tolkien fanboys he put three films under his nose, as it could not have imagined in their wildest dreams. Already the first part of the trilogy was a great success (grossing 870 million dollars) and was already the cost of production for the whole trilogy again ($ 330 million). Winner of four Academy Awards created this film ideal conditions for the success of the second part, which, as expected, outperformed financially the first (925 million dollars). the world feverishly excited about the year 2003, to finally see the finale of the series, is further sensational success Another record broken and were safe. And was it then: &#8220;The Lord of the Rings: The Return of the King&#8221; closed perfectly the story of the ring off, Frodo&#8217;s odyssey ended through hell and thus made ​​the &#8220;Lord of the Rings&#8221; trilogy, the most successful film series of all time Peter Jackson and one of the most influential men in Hollywood.<span id="more-132"></span></p>

<p>The time line of history, however, Peter Jackson changed for the good of dramaturgy emerges Thus, in the novels, for example, the spider &#8220;Shelob&#8221; already in &#8221; The Two Towers &#8220;on, Denethor falls not down the cliff, but burns in the crypt and Elendil sword is forged in the first volume again. But these are only small changes and assist in the creation of suspense and emotion.</p>
<p>The soundtrack was, as it was in &#8221; The Two Towers &#8220;, a few pieces by Howard Shore expanded and underline, as in the predecessors of all possible situations just perfect. With heavy drums, when the orcs advance, with violins, when the riders of Rohan dash into the enemy masses, with small flutes, when the little hobbits are seen. The variety of instruments like the violin, the dulcimer, the cimbalom, the celesta, the pan and the wooden flute or the drum and the anvil produce the feeling that Middle Earth is actually a real world. With their own cultures and languages. And just different music.</p>
